[0002] With the development of modern blood transfusion technology, the use of various components and cells in blood has become an effective means of clinical treatment. Hematopoietic stem cells are adult stem cells in the blood system. They are a heterogeneous group with long-term self-renewal ability and the potential to differentiate into various types of mature blood cells. Red blood cells, platelets, and hematopoietic stem cell components, which are commonly used in clinical treatment, are prone to bacterial contamination due to storage conditions and collection methods.
